Ford Shropshire

A summer afternoon concert at Ford church. The concert was well attended and enjoyed by a very supportive audience. After the performance a tasty spread of warm excellent soups, and buffet food was provided by the organisers followed by a large selection of puddings and cakes.


Once again the quire was hidden behind a Rood Screen but sang and played with gusto thanks to our enthusiastic quire master.



In 1780 John Wesley said  "Sing lustily and with a good courage. Beware of singing as if you were half dead, or half asleep." and our Quire Master made a very enthusiastic effort to get the Quire doing just that.

Clunbury

 


The Quire performed an afternoon concert in the lovely village of Clunbury. We were made very welcome and provided fine refreshments after the concert.

The performance was West Gallery Music through the year, with some historic facts given by members of the quire.

A very well attended concert.
